2009-08-10 7 views
1

J'améliore le projet de 1.1 à 3.5.
Il reste des références aux assemblys .NET 1.1. La question est:
Ai-je besoin d'avoir à la fois .NET 1.1 et 2.0 (3.5) sur la machine déployée ou il peut être exécuté sans 1.1?Assemblage .NET 1.1 dans le projet .NET 2.0: .NET 1.1 est-il requis?

Cheers,
Dmitriy.

+0

avez-vous essayé d'utiliser le gestionnaire de mise à niveau pour votre projet dans Visual Studio? – Jason

+0

Le projet n'est pas dans Visual Studio (Borland C# Builder), donc je ne peux pas le faire. –

Répondre

4

Si vous référencez une version spécifique de l'assembly (c'est-à-dire que la version spécifique est définie sur true dans les propriétés des références), alors oui, vous aurez besoin des deux.

Si vous n'êtes pas référencez versions spécifiques, alors non, vous aurez pas besoin à la fois, et que votre demande devrait être en mesure d'utiliser les 3,0 ensembles (bien que vous prenez vos chances de ne pas tester spécifiquement 3.0!)

+1

Il apparaît que l'OP n'a qu'une seule version (construite sur .NET 1.1) de l'assemblage concerné. – Cerebrus

Questions connexes